Transaction 107be50873822b8de91f33beca73b7b34104f87248c2c43f8395237c95d6d7ca

1 Input
2 Outputs
  • 107be50873822b8de91f33beca73b7b34104f87248c2c43f8395237c95d6d7ca:0
  • value  5000
    address  126sDDZsLjfrL77VYBUqSrGFTWdT9pbs9x
  • 107be50873822b8de91f33beca73b7b34104f87248c2c43f8395237c95d6d7ca:1
  • value  23903881
    address  bc1q4ctpfa77h864f7zntgq2n95d4psq86jjupe8np